TOP #621 COLLEGE

University Of Puerto Rico Rio Piedras

San Juan, PR

4-year

Established in 1903, the University of Puerto Rico, Río Piedras Campus (UPRRP) is the oldest institution of Higher Education in Puerto Rico. Since 2018 UPRRP is classified as Doctoral Universities: High Research Activity by the Carnegie Classification of Institutions of Higher Education, the only among comparable institutions in Puerto Rico. Nobel laureates who have served in our campus: Gabriela Mistral, Juan Ramón Jiménez, Saul Bellow, James Tobin and Mario Vargas Llosa. It offers 123 programs (50 accredited), of...
